2 Aging, Photo damaged Skin Sagging skin on the neck, decollete, face along with wrinkles and body are common problems associated with aging. RF & ULTRASOUND system is the most commonly used procedure to stimulate the tissue production and strengthen the skin structure. HIFU enables skin tightening and improvement of the skin s appearance painlessly without post-op downtime of classic surgery applications or other invasive methods.

15 HIFU Proposed more than 50years ago (1942, Lynn) Remained research field until 1990s Several clinical trials for the treatment of benign and malignant tumors of the prostate, bladder and kidney Applied in dermatology area only a few years ago

26 The mean ± SD depths of the facial nerve main nerve trunk, 20.1±3.1 mm, and nerve exit from the parotid edge, 9.1±2.8mmfor temporal, 9.2±2.2mmfor zygomatic, 9.6±2.0 mm for buccal, 10.6±2.7 mm for mandibular branches.
